- Tilt the screen, place it in such a manner that the display colours should be altered by pulling forward on the top of the screen and when you push it the angle should be changed.
- Now, click the Start button on your desktop and choose Control Panel.
- To end that, navigate the pointer at the control panel and click it.
- From the menus that appear, choose Appearance and Personalisation to continue.
- As you click it, a window will appear on your desktop, here, here choose Display Properties.
- In the options, choose the Colour Correction to adjust/reduce it.
- If you don’t find or the options are not available here, go back to your desktop.
- Now, on the desktop, right-click using the mouse.
- Here, from the context menu that pops up, click Personalise and then again follow the same procedure.
- Using the slider readjust it. For low brightness, turn your slider to the left position.
